-32.92515589, 151.7541826The youth 2-star Backpackers Newcastle Hostel is located approximately 10 minutes' drive from Novocastrian Park and features a sundeck, a terrace, and billiards. Offering a car park nearby, the hostel is within close proximity of Hunter Valley.
Location
Nearby shopping destinations comprise Newcastle Entertainment And Convention Centre Nex (1.2 km) and Newcastle City Farmers Market (2.4 km) for visitors to explore. This hostel is also approximately 10 minutes by car from sports attractions, such as Newcastle International Sports Centre Stadium.
Williamtown airport is 30 km from the accommodation, and Parkway Av Opp Skelton St bus stop is approximately a 10-minute walk away.

Guests can relax in the shared bathrooms equipped with amenities like a shower. Also, the presence of towels in the bathrooms ensures a comfortable stay.
Eat & Drink
Green Roof Grill Restaurant offers Australian dishes and is located within walking distance of the hostel. There is a shared kitchen at this accommodation.
Leisure & Business
A shared lounge area features WiFi and a TV.

The cleanliness of the room and bathroom was outstanding, making for a pleasant stay. The shower had great water pressure, surpassing expectations. We were impressed with the manager, Chris, who had a fantastic personality and went above and beyond to make our stay enjoyable. The hostel had a great atmosphere, being both fun and relaxing, and ensured a peaceful night's sleep. The facilities, including the garden and pool, were top-notch. The breakfast provided was a step above typical hostel fare, with high-quality products like "Bonne Maman" jam. The free BBQ on Monday night exceeded expectations, with delicious food prepared for us. It was evident that the manager truly cared for the guests, creating an awesome experience.
